Proverbs 17:15-17
King James Version
15 He that justifieth the wicked, and he that condemneth the just, even they both are abomination to the Lord.
16 Wherefore is there a price in the hand of a fool to get wisdom, seeing he hath no heart to it?
17 A friend loveth at all times, and a brother is born for adversity.

Proverbs 17:15-17
English Standard Version
15 He who (A)justifies the wicked and he who (B)condemns the righteous
are both alike an abomination to the Lord.
16 Why should a fool have money in his hand (C)to buy wisdom
when he has no sense?
17 (D)A friend loves at all times,
and a brother is born for adversity.
